Description

Boron Trifluoride-Acetic Acid Complex CAS NO 7578-36-1 is a versatile and powerful Lewis acid catalyst, formed by the coordination of boron trifluoride with acetic acid. This complex is essential for facilitating a wide range of organic synthesis reactions, particularly Friedel-Crafts acylations and alkylations, where it offers superior catalytic activity and selectivity. It is a critical reagent for chemical manufacturers and R&D laboratories in the pharmaceutical, agrochemical, and specialty chemical industries seeking efficient and reliable synthetic pathways.

Application

  • Catalyst for Friedel-Crafts Reactions: Primarily used as a highly effective catalyst for acylations and alkylations, enabling the synthesis of aromatic ketones and other intermediates.
  • Pharmaceutical Intermediate Synthesis: A key reagent in the production of active pharmaceutical ingredients (APIs) and complex organic molecules.
  • Polymerization Initiator/Catalyst: Employed in the polymerization of specific monomers, such as in the production of certain resins and elastomers.
  • Agrochemical Manufacturing: Used in the synthesis of herbicides, pesticides, and other crop protection agents.
  • Dye and Pigment Production: Facilitates synthesis steps in the manufacture of organic dyes and colorants.
  • Laboratory Reagent: Serves as a standard Lewis acid catalyst in research and development for novel organic transformations.
  • Esterification and Condensation Reactions: Acts as a catalyst to promote ester formation and other condensation processes.

Basic Information

Product Name Boron Trifluoride-Acetic Acid Complex
CAS No. 7578-36-1
Molecular Formula C2H4BF3O2
Molecular Weight 127.86 g/mol
Synonyms Acetic Acid-Boron Trifluoride Complex; Boron Trifluoride Acetate; BF3-Acetic Acid Complex; Boron Fluoride-Acetic Acid Adduct; Trifluoroborane-Acetic Acid (1:1); Acetic Acid, Compd. with Boron Trifluoride (1:1); Boron Trifluoride Monoacetate
EINECS 231-480-5

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area away from incompatible materials. Due to its hygroscopic (moisture-sensitive) nature, containers should be kept tightly sealed and under an inert atmosphere if necessary. Recommended storage temperature is 2-8°C to maintain stability.
